The Role:

Working with the Principal Engineer, you will be working on multiple projects, responsible for manufacturing problem identification and resolution:

  • Support existing manufacturing lines and new product introduction
  • Support the industrial validation process through the use of FMEA's, process proving activities etc.
  • Management of configuration control by the embodiment of design modifications into the manufacturing documentation and industrial validation
  • Support the non-conformance process
  • Ensure products are produced with consideration to safety, efficiency and economic factors
  • Assume the responsibilities for safe operating implementation for changed processes, including liaising with COSHH assessors, SHE and human factors
  • Liaise with the design authority during the product prototype/development phase, to ensure optimised Design for Manufacture (DfM)
  • Compilation and update of Manufacturing Instructions maintaining production BOMs
  • Tooling development and control
